Horrid House by Gary R. Hess
This poem was one of my first attempts at creating more of a story line compared to works written before this. I wrote it for a creative writing class in college.
Poem
Category: Miscellaneous "Horrid House" Away for a while But still there Your senses linger Through the air Howls of silence A gentle feeling Laughter of anger Through the ceiling Painful thoughts Of things to come Wondering, thinking Of paths sought What will come Through this journey Happiness, joy Or pain and misery Ghosts still wonder From ancients past Getting closer You see their masks Scared and frightened You rush to the door Locked, bolted You cannot endure Footsteps louder Creeping near Scan left, right Nothing there You turn A shadow appears Running as quickly As your tears Weeping violently You smell the air Blood and urine Is the atmosphere You creep forward And brush your hair You notice something That isn't fair Hair has fallen In your hand you stare Wailing louder In the dull air Look ahead And all you see Groans occurring Blood of sea Run fast Across the room Something's coming Cannot see Stumble do not Or shall be killed Run faster Or horror slay You see a mirror On the wall You see your name On grave been lay The horror came And cannot stop Your life is gone In hell you stay by Gary R. New version:"Horrid House" - Renewed
I. Away for a while But still there Their senses linger Through the air Howls of silence A gentle feeling Laughter of anger Through the ceiling Painful thoughts Of whats still there With a wonder You'll be there What will come With this journey Pain and tears Or bliss and cheers? II. As you enter The night begins With wraiths waiting In the darkness Scared and frightened You slam the door Locked, bolted Can't endure Ghosts still wonder From ancients past Getting closer You see their masks Footsteps louder Creeping near Pan left, pan right Nothing there While you turn A shadow appears Running as quickly As your tears Weeping violently You smell the air Blood and urine Fill the atmosphere You creep forward And stroke your hair You feel something Not so fair Goo has fallen From your hair Wailing louder You must stare Look ahead Nothing to see Groans occur Now, Blood of sea Running faster Across the room Something's coming But cannot see As you run You see a light Somethings glowing But not bright You see a mirror Across the hall You see writing Upon the wall "The horrors came To seek revenge Their lives were taken By our forsaken" "To cure this curse You must do worse Take this knife And do your worst" You grab the knife And hold it tight Ripping bowels From your side Fall to the floor And die slowly You see the ghosts A bit more clearly
